The “kollection” includes the movies “Mortal Kombat” (1995) and “Mortal Kombat: Annihilation” (1997), each debuting on 4K UHD Blu-ray. Paul W.S. Anderson directed Mortal Kombat, which starred Christopher Lambert, Robin Shou, Linden Ashby, Cary-Hiroyuki Tagawa, Bridgette Wilson-Sampras, Trevor Goddard, and Talisa Soto. Mortal Kombat: Annihilation was directed by John R. Leonetti. The second film starred Robin Shou, Talisa Soto, James Remar, Sandra Hess, Lynn ‘Red’ Williams, Brian Thompson, Irina Pantaeva, and Chris Conrad.

Each movie has received a new 4K restoration by Arrow Films from the original camera negatives. The director of each film approved the presentations. The tech specs for the 4K UHD Blu-ray include a 2160p video presentation in a 1.85:1 aspect ratio [for each film] with Dolby Vision (HDR10-compatible) high dynamic range, along with lossless DTS-HD Master Audio 5.1 surround and 2.0 stereo sound. The 2-disc set will feature each movie on its own individual 4K disc.

The 2011 comedy Bridesmaids is coming to 4K UHD Blu-ray on May 12th via Universal Studios Home Entertainment.

It’s worth noting that the movie is celebrating its 15th Anniversary, with a majority of the cast having a reunion onstage at the 2026 Academy Awards just this past Sunday. Paul Feig directed the movie, which Kristen Wiig co-wrote, and Judd Apatow produced. It starred Kristen Wiig, Maya Rudolph, Rose Byrne, Wendi McLendon-Covey, Ellie Kemper, and Melissa McCarthy. The supporting cast included Rebel Wilson, Chris O’Dowd, Matt Lucas, Tim Heidecker, and Terry Crews.

The tech specs for the 4K UHD Blu-ray include a 2160p video presentation in a 2.40:1 aspect ratio, Dolby Vision (HDR10 compatible) high dynamic range, and Dolby Atmos sound, on a BD-100 disc. The release will be a 2-disc “combo pack” with its Blu-ray Disc counterpart included. This release will feature both the UNRATED [131 minutes] cut and the theatrical version [125 minutes], both in 4K. This will include a digital code (copy) of the film compatible with Movies Anywhere.
